## About OpenCV
|
||||
To compile and install OpenCV4 with contrib us the script ```install_OpenCV4.sh```. It will download and compile OpenCV in Download folder.
|
||||
```
|
||||
bash install_OpenCV4.sh
|
||||
```
|
||||
When using openCV not compiled with contrib, comment the definition of OPENCV_CUDACONTRIBCONTRIB in include/tkDNN/DetectionNN.h. When commented, the preprocessing of the networks is computed on the CPU, otherwise on the GPU. In the latter case some milliseconds are saved in the end-to-end latency.
